  • Page 11: Speed Droop

    The speed governor must have a speed droop of 3-4% (speed dropping 3-4% from no load to full load, when the multi-line 2 is not in control). In order to ensure equal load sharing on parallel running machines, all governors must have the same droop setting.

  • Page 14: Voltage Droop

    This means that the generator AVR must have a voltage droop of 3-4% (voltage dropping 3-4% from no load to full reactive load when the multi-line 2 has no control). In order to ensure equal var sharing on parallel running generators, all generators must have the same voltage droop setting.

  • Page 17: Adjustment Hints For Agc

    Multi-line 2 General Guidelines for Commissioning Adjustment hints for AGC This concerns the AGC only! In many cases it is difficult to tune in the controller using load jumps (no load bank available). When this is the situation, the manual incr/decr inputs can be used in semi-auto mode. The inputs are digital inputs that must be configured in the utility software.
